Velvet-Bird
27.09.2012 18:02
Обновил GTK/GLib/ещё какую-то хуйню, теперь сегфолтится Pidgin и дохуя чего. Что делать?
Обновил GTK/GLib/ещё какую-то хуйню, теперь сегфолтится Pidgin и дохуя чего. Что делать?
Что за дистр?
Прыще-LFS
Чаще всего вот такая хуйня всплывает: (gtk3-demo:12262): Pango-CRITICAL **: pango_glyph_item_split: assertion `split_index < orig→item→length' failed
inb4 ДОЛЖНЫ СТРАДАТЬ
Ну, хуй его знает.
ставь убунту, там норм
Лучше подскажи что чинить и как?
ставь сперму
rm — rf /*
pango обновлял? Если нет — обнови. `paco -da1 --sort=d` чо показывает?
по вене
Обновлял, всё равно хуйня.
27-Sep-2012 glib-2.34.0
27-Sep-2012 gdk-pixbuf-2.26.4
27-Sep-2012 at-spi2-core-2.6.0
27-Sep-2012 atk-2.6.0
27-Sep-2012 at-spi2-atk-2.6.0
27-Sep-2012 harfbuzz-0.9.4
27-Sep-2012 gtk+-2.24.13
27-Sep-2012 gtk+-3.6.0
27-Sep-2012 gnome-backgrounds-3.6.0
27-Sep-2012 pidgin-2.10.6
27-Sep-2012 pixman-0.26.2
27-Sep-2012 libpng-1.5.12
27-Sep-2012 cairo-1.12.2
27-Sep-2012 gnome-icon-theme-3.6.0
27-Sep-2012 gnome-icon-theme-extras-3.4.0
27-Sep-2012 gnome-icon-theme-symbolic-3.6.0
27-Sep-2012 gnome-themes-standard-3.6.0.2
27-Sep-2012 nautilus-3.6.0
27-Sep-2012 gsettings-desktop-schemas-3.6.0
27-Sep-2012 vte-0.34.0
27-Sep-2012 gnome-terminal-3.6.0
27-Sep-2012 eog-3.6.0
27-Sep-2012 file-roller-3.6.0
27-Sep-2012 evince-3.6.0
27-Sep-2012 pango-1.32.0
27-Sep-2012 freetype-2.4.10
27-Sep-2012 fontconfig-2.10.1
ппц ты хуйни понаставил лол
Наобновлял
так оно у тебя сегфолтиться или pango assert вылезает? Или при assert'е тоже падает?
gtk3-demo, если зайти в Help→About, то ассерт и сегфолт сразу же, в пиджине просто сегфолт
ПРИШЛО ВРЕМЯ GDB
Program received signal SIGSEGV, Segmentation fault.
0xb6d49035 in _int_malloc () from /lib/libc.so.6
(gdb) bt full
#0 0xb6d49035 in _int_malloc () from /lib/libc.so.6
No symbol table info available.
#1 0xb6d4b891 in malloc () from /lib/libc.so.6
No symbol table info available.
#2 0xb713eb33 in standard_realloc (mem=0x0, n_bytes=160) at gmem.c:92
No locals.
#3 0xb713f2e9 in g_realloc (mem=0x0, n_bytes=160) at gmem.c:224
newmem = <optimized out>
#4 0xb74786ba in pango_glyph_string_set_size (string=0x8422760, new_len=6) at glyphstring.c:89
__PRETTY_FUNCTION__ = "pango_glyph_string_set_size"
#5 0xb7fc77d8 in basic_engine_shape (engine=0x8226120, font=0x82b8028, item_text=0x840f46f " || %t = ", item_length=6, analysis=0x834a99c,
glyphs=0x8422760, paragraph_text=0x840f430 "%a = user || %y = downloads || %b = || %n = b460e0724660 || %t = ", paragraph_length=74)
at basic-fc.c:374
context = {ft_face = 0x82a1dc8, fc_font = 0x82b8028, vertical = 0, improper_sign = 1}
fc_font = 0x82b8028
ft_face = <optimized out>
hb_face = 0x82a3c58
hb_font = 0x82c5ce8
hb_buffer = 0x82a9638
hb_direction = <optimized out>
free_buffer = 0
is_hinted = <optimized out>
hb_glyph = 0x84a0d40
hb_position = <optimized out>
last_cluster = <optimized out>
i = <optimized out>
num_glyphs = 6
__PRETTY_FUNCTION__ = "basic_engine_shape"
#6 0xb748078e in _pango_engine_shape_shape (engine=0x8226120, font=0x82b8028, item_text=0x840f46f " || %t = ", item_length=6,
paragraph_text=0x840f430 "%a = user || %y = downloads || %b = || %n = b460e0724660 || %t = ", paragraph_len=74, analysis=0x834a99c,
glyphs=0x8422760) at pango-engine.c:96
No locals.
#7 0xb7491a55 in pango_shape_full (item_text=0x840f46f " || %t = ", item_length=6,
paragraph_text=0x840f430 "%a = user || %y = downloads || %b = || %n = b460e0724660 || %t = ", paragraph_length=74, analysis=0x834a99c,
glyphs=0x8422760) at shape.c:106
i = <optimized out>
last_cluster = <optimized out>
__PRETTY_FUNCTION__ = "pango_shape_full"
#8 0xb7471ce6 in shape_run (line=0x84c7f18, state=0xbfffdfb4, item=0x834a990) at pango-layout.c:3184
layout = 0x849ae60
glyphs = 0x8422760
#9 0xb7471fd1 in process_item (layout=0x849ae60, line=0x84c7f18, state=0xbfffdfb4, force_fit=1, no_break_at_end=0) at pango-layout.c:3297
item = 0x834a990
width = <optimized out>
length = <optimized out>
i = <optimized out>
---Type <return> to continue, or q <return> to quit---
поставь pango-1.30.1 и не еби мозг
Теперь норм. Спасибо, Славик :3
лол
bash-4.2$ gimp
*** glibc detected *** gimp: malloc(): memory corruption: 0x00000000038b5b70 ***
======= Backtrace: =========
/lib/libc.so.6(+0x735fa)[0x7fa8958ad5fa]
/lib/libc.so.6(+0x74fea)[0x7fa8958aefea]
/lib/libc.so.6(__libc_malloc+0x6d)[0x7fa8958b0fcd]
/usr/lib/libglib-2.0.so.0(g_realloc+0x17)[0x7fa895e26b67]
/usr/lib/libpango-1.0.so.0(pango_glyph_string_set_size+0x48)[0x7fa897bacc58]
/usr/lib/pango/1.8.0/modules/pango-basic-fc.so(+0x1d31)[0x7fa88d695d31]
/usr/lib/libpango-1.0.so.0(pango_shape_full+0xbb)[0x7fa897bc33ab]
/usr/lib/libpango-1.0.so.0(+0xf9b4)[0x7fa897ba69b4]
/usr/lib/libpango-1.0.so.0(+0xfa7e)[0x7fa897ba6a7e]
/usr/lib/libpango-1.0.so.0(+0xff5b)[0x7fa897ba6f5b]
/usr/lib/libpango-1.0.so.0(+0x22aeb)[0x7fa897bb9aeb]
/usr/lib/libpango-1.0.so.0(+0x238f7)[0x7fa897bba8f7]
/usr/lib/libgtk-x11-2.0.so.0(+0x12b85b)[0x7fa899aa285b]
/usr/lib/libgtk-x11-2.0.so.0(+0x12d22d)[0x7fa899aa422d]
/usr/lib/libgobject-2.0.so.0(g_cclosure_marshal_VOID__BOXEDv+0x9e)[0x7fa8964f5d2 e]
/usr/lib/libgobject-2.0.so.0(+0xfdeb)[0x7fa8964f2deb]
/usr/lib/libgobject-2.0.so.0(g_signal_emit_valist+0x4f8)[0x7fa89650b518]
/usr/lib/libgobject-2.0.so.0(g_signal_emit_by_name+0x4c5)[0x7fa89650c3f5]
/usr/lib/libgtk-x11-2.0.so.0(+0x1a58e8)[0x7fa899b1c8e8]
/usr/lib/libgtk-x11-2.0.so.0(+0x87955)[0x7fa8999fe955]
gimp[0x5b556c]
/usr/lib/libgobject-2.0.so.0(g_cclosure_marshal_VOID__BOXEDv+0x9e)[0x7fa8964f5d2 e]
/usr/lib/libgobject-2.0.so.0(+0xfdeb)[0x7fa8964f2deb]
/usr/lib/libgobject-2.0.so.0(g_signal_emit_valist+0x4f8)[0x7fa89650b518]
/usr/lib/libgobject-2.0.so.0(g_signal_emit_by_name+0x4c5)[0x7fa89650c3f5]
/usr/lib/libgtk-x11-2.0.so.0(+0x1a58e8)[0x7fa899b1c8e8]
/usr/lib/libgtk-x11-2.0.so.0(+0x87955)[0x7fa8999fe955]
/usr/lib/libgobject-2.0.so.0(g_cclosure_marshal_VOID__BOXEDv+0x9e)[0x7fa8964f5d2 e]
/usr/lib/libgobject-2.0.so.0(+0xfdeb)[0x7fa8964f2deb]
/usr/lib/libgobject-2.0.so.0(g_signal_emit_valist+0x4f8)[0x7fa89650b518]
/usr/lib/libgobject-2.0.so.0(g_signal_emit_by_name+0x4c5)[0x7fa89650c3f5]
/usr/lib/libgtk-x11-2.0.so.0(+0x1a58e8)[0x7fa899b1c8e8]
/usr/lib/libgtk-x11-2.0.so.0(+0x87955)[0x7fa8999fe955]
/usr/lib/libgobject-2.0.so.0(g_cclosure_marshal_VOID__BOXEDv+0x9e)[0x7fa8964f5d2 e]
/usr/lib/libgobject-2.0.so.0(+0xfdeb)[0x7fa8964f2deb]
/usr/lib/libgobject-2.0.so.0(g_signal_emit_valist+0x4f8)[0x7fa89650b518]
/usr/lib/libgobject-2.0.so.0(g_signal_emit_by_name+0x4c5)[0x7fa89650c3f5]
/usr/lib/libgtk-x11-2.0.so.0(+0x1a58e8)[0x7fa899b1c8e8]
/usr/lib/libgtk-x11-2.0.so.0(+0x25e49c)[0x7fa899bd549c]
/usr/lib/libgobject-2.0.so.0(g_cclosure_marshal_VOID__BOXEDv+0x9e)[0x7fa8964f5d2 e]
/usr/lib/libgobject-2.0.so.0(+0xfeb7)[0x7fa8964f2eb7]
/usr/lib/libgobject-2.0.so.0(g_signal_emit_valist+0x4f8)[0x7fa89650b518]
/usr/lib/libgobject-2.0.so.0(g_signal_emit_by_name+0x4c5)[0x7fa89650c3f5]
/usr/lib/libgtk-x11-2.0.so.0(+0x1a58e8)[0x7fa899b1c8e8]
/usr/lib/libgtk-x11-2.0.so.0(+0x25f021)[0x7fa899bd6021]
/usr/lib/libgtk-x11-2.0.so.0(+0x26182b)[0x7fa899bd882b]
/usr/lib/libgobject-2.0.so.0(+0xfeb7)[0x7fa8964f2eb7]
/usr/lib/libgobject-2.0.so.0(g_signal_emit_valist+0x4f8)[0x7fa89650b518]
/usr/lib/libgobject-2.0.so.0(g_signal_emit+0x82)[0x7fa89650bf22]
/usr/lib/libgtk-x11-2.0.so.0(gtk_widget_show+0x86)[0x7fa899bceeb6]
gimp(gui_message+0x16d)[0x4899ed]
gimp(gimp_show_message+0x11a)[0x68e57a]
gimp[0x7315af]
gimp(file_open_image+0x430)[0x7319f0]
gimp(file_open_with_proc_and_display+0x196)[0x7321e6]
gimp[0x4b27ab]
gimp[0x4b2ae8]
/usr/lib/libgobject-2.0.so.0(g_closure_invoke+0x190)[0x7fa8964f2bf0]
/usr/lib/libgobject-2.0.so.0(+0x20f68)[0x7fa896503f68]
/usr/lib/libgobject-2.0.so.0(g_signal_emit_valist+0xdbe)[0x7fa89650bdde]
/usr/lib/libgobject-2.0.so.0(g_signal_emit+0x82)[0x7fa89650bf22]
/usr/lib/libgobject-2.0.so.0(+0xfeb7)[0x7fa8964f2eb7]
/usr/lib/libgobject-2.0.so.0(g_signal_emit_valist+0x4f8)[0x7fa89650b518]
======= Memory map: ========
ОБНОВИЛ!
Теперь даунгрейдни
ни в коем случае
Ах ты сука, я сейчас твой sshd хакну и сам даунгрейдну
лучше бы ты мой бекдор хакнул, евпочя
http://ftp.gnome.org/pub/GNOME/sources/p...
Можно обновляться?
да
Клёво, ща попробую